As an Enterprise Account Director, you will drive the growth of Opus 2 solutions within the world’s leading law firms.
You will build and expand strategic relationships within a portfolio of large law firms, identifying high-value opportunities and leading enterprise sales cycles from discovery through to close. This includes expanding existing Opus 2 subscriptions into new case teams, introducing the platform into additional offices where it may already be used in another geography (for example expanding from US offices into the UK or EMEA office).
The majority of opportunities in this role come from identifying new case teams, use cases, or offices within large law firms and expanding Opus 2’s footprint through strategic account development, including introducing new capabilities such as AI into existing client workflows.
In some cases, the role may also involve developing opportunities with firms that are not yet Opus 2 customers, although the primary focus is expanding Opus 2’s footprint within existing strategic accounts.
This role requires a highly proactive enterprise seller who can independently create and progress opportunities and who can take full ownership of progressing deals from initial engagement through to close.
Successful candidates operate with autonomy and pace while managing complex, multi-stakeholder enterprise sales cycles.
Enterprise Account Directors manage the full deal lifecycle while working closely with internal teams across Solutions Consulting, Customer Success, Marketing, Product, and Hearings.

Opus 2 builds innovative legal software and services that streamline litigation and arbitration processes for law firms around the world. Our cloud-based solutions enhance collaboration among legal teams and empower them to deliver value through efficient document management, court reporting, and AI-assisted tools. By creating a connected digital practice, we help legal professionals focus on what truly matters – deepening client engagement and differentiating their services.
